在线JS解密工具有哪些?揭秘那些让代码乖乖现形的小伙伴!

2025-07-30 3:14:19 密语知识 思思

小伙伴们,是不是偶尔逛代码时,看见那一堆密密麻麻的JS,就像遇到了天书一样懵圈?想要秒变“代码福尔摩斯”,来一波在线JS解密工具的种草分享,帮你轻松搞定各种JS加密、混淆,瞬间看穿“代码迷雾”。今天,我就带着搜遍十几家网站后的“独家内参”,给你安排上最全、最实用的在线JS解密工具。一篇文章读完,代码世界任你游,保证秒开脑洞,犹如吃下了“代码大力丸”!快快往下看,别眨眼!

话说,JS加密这事本身就是程序员的“魔术”,把普通明明白白的代码变成了“神秘黑盒”,观众看了直呼“难以琢磨”。而我们的任务,就是当那个拆魔术的主角,甩出在线解密工具,把魔术还原成最初的样子。别问我为什么这么热情,毕竟谁不想做个打码界的“007”呢?

先安利几款老司机经常用到的在线JS解密神器:

1. JSBeautifier —— 免费、操作简单的一键美化神器。它可不光是美化代码那么简单,还能帮你把压缩和混淆后的JS代码拉直撩得清清爽爽,适合各种初学者和技术小白。打开网页,把你的加密内容粘进去,神奇的格式化功能让你像剥洋葱一样一层层剥开代码,足矣。体验感:还挺像给代码做了“spa”!

2. De4js —— 这个工具大名鼎鼎,号称“解密界冲锋枪”。支持多种加密类型(Packer、Obfuscator等等),“一键解密,爽到飞起”。只要你的JS不是炒冷饭,这个工具几乎根本不怕!特别适合懒癌晚期的同学,不用折腾复杂操作,它帮你盯住解密大门。它还有网页版,操作搓一搓都爽!

3. JSNice —— 这个家伙不止帮你解密居家旅行必备的“代码阔刀”,还能自动给变量起名,好比你家那个没被取名的宠物狗,JSNice一来帮你“正名”。用了它,你的代码不仅能看懂,还能明白为毛写脚本的小哥会长那样。直接APointed!

4. Unpacker工具合集 —— 这些属于专门针对某些加密格式的“套路炸弹”,比如著名的Packer、AAencode、URL encode等,专拆混淆脚本的“神兵利器”。你可以往里面加点料,在线拆得空前顺畅,感觉像用上了代码界的“神秘钥匙”。

说到这儿,有些小伙伴可能激动地问,“我是不是只要有了以上工具就能无敌了?”嘿,小声说,哪有那么简单!JS解密虽然听起来像个华丽的魔法,但经常你还得动动脑筋,分辨加密方式,不然工具放那种加密毫无效果,跟你去火星刷夜市差不多。别慌,慢慢来,邪门的JS套路多,老司机都有自己的“点子手册”!

好嘞,我们再来秒换一个风格,给你补充几个冷门但超高效的在线解密宝藏:

5. Pretty Diff —— 这个工具是个多面手,除了美化代码,还能进行代码差异对比、压缩及解密。遇到JS混淆代码,扔给它,你会惊讶地发现代码“秒变清晰世界”,简直像给迷雾戴了个“GPS定位器”。

6. JS Decoder —— 直截了当的在线JS解码工具,支持多种加密格式,还能展示解密的详细过程,让你像破解密室一样,有迹可循。对那些喜欢探案的同学特别友好。

7. Javascript Deobfuscator (Chrome插件) —— 如果你不想折腾在线网页,还想有酷炫的插件随时弹出来,这款插件问题不大。吹爆它的“自动识别混淆代码,实时美化”的功能,帮你把加密变得像没加密一样透明。

当然,约等于“神器”的全自动工具之外,咱们还是不能忘了靠自己脑洞大开的廉价“破绽”,比如:

1. 阅读代码上下文,找关键函数入口,反复试验;

2. 结合Chrome DevTools的断点调试,跟踪执行流程和变量变化;

3. 利用正则表达式快速找出隐藏字符和编码细节。

这一套操作,虽然有点“手动液”,但也能让你的解密技术一路开挂,成就感爆棚!别光盯着工具,当你自己会读代码时,少一个工具都无所谓——就像玩游戏想要赚零花钱,不一定非得打怪,也能抓住七评赏金榜的门票,网站地址:bbs.77.ink。

顺带说一句,网络上还有不少工具,每个都自带“666”的气场,但实际用起来嘛,有的只能把代码打扮得花枝招展,却不真解密;有的卡得跟冬眠一样,敲代码敲到敲碗。咱们挑选时心里要有数,别浪费时间和流量跑偏路。

最后,简单教你一个小妙招:先用JSBeautifier格式化代码,之后用De4js解密,最后用JSNice来给变量命名——三剑合璧,代码原形毕露,分分钟有种“拆炸弹少年团”上线的赶脚!

咋样?这波在线JS解密工具介绍够全面吧?做到这步,是不是觉得自己可以和“密室逃脱”组队合作了?但别忘了……代码解密偶尔也得玩点脑筋急转弯,谁说解密就一定非得板着脸敲代码?要不我问你:

为什么程序员在解密JS代码时,总喜欢带着眼镜?——因为这样才不会被代码的迷雾“闪瞎”啊!